Rider killed after motorcycle crash - Turramurra

A man has died following a motorcycle crash in Sydney's north today.

About 9.10am (Sunday 25 April 2021), a motorcycle was travelling along The Comenarra Parkway at Turramurra, when the rider lost control and crashed into a tree.

Emergency services were notified and arrived a short time later.

The 30-year-old man was treated at the scene before being taken to Royal North Shore Hospital where he later died.

Officers attached to Ku-ring-gai Police Area Command established a crime scene, which has been forensically examined.

Police are appealing for anyone who may have witnessed or have dashcam footage of the incident to contact Crime Stoppers.

A report will be prepared for the Coroner.
